Roland SH3 vs SH3A: Direct Filter & Oscillator Comparison


video upload by Vintage Synthesizer Solutions

"This was filmed on very short notice, so apologies for the video quality. We had these 2 in the shop together and were exploring their significant sonic differences. We decided it deserved to be filmed and shared for others to reference.

@2:31 I accidentally leave the 3a on the sawtooth oscillator setting for a few seconds while playing the 3's (on top) square wave. I quickly realize this and adjust accoridingly shortly after." -- Tuning and parametersettings between the two seem off at times. Note the difference between :50 and :52 followed by later settings along with the differences mentioned above after 2:31. Still interesting from the perspective of hearing their raw sound / what they sound like.
